ArcGIS多数据框联动批量出图

2024-04-19 01:12

本文主要是介绍ArcGIS多数据框联动批量出图,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

    这次内容是《ArcPy结合数据驱动模块的批量制图》课程的新增内容。学完这个课程大家对arcgis的数据驱动页面的批量出图应该是驾轻就熟,不管是无编程的完全基于ArcGIS数据驱动模块批量出图还是结合ArcPy的Mapping模块批量出图(arcpy.mapping)。

这次呢,我们要介绍大家在工作中十分需要的多数据框联动批量出图。

这次课程新增的的两个内容是:

无编程四数据框联动批量出图

arcpy实现多数据框批量联动出图

下面先来看之前课程的几个插图

 点击链接学习

ArcPy结合数据驱动模块的批量制图(GIS思维)icon-default.png?t=N7T8https://edu.csdn.net/course/detail/28073

图片

图片

厦门市地表覆盖批量分幅出图

图片

福建省各个区县自动化批量出图

01 无编程四数据框联动批量出图


第一个新增的内容就是如何通过无编程的操作实现四(多)数据框联动批量出图。

如下图所示,我行了配置,将一个图斑的以电子街道地图、2014年影像图、2020年影像图、2023年影像图同时在一个页面进行显示,多个图斑就可以实现批量出图了。

图片

        但是,我们在设置数据驱动页面的时候,只有设置了数据页面的数据会动,其他数据框的并没有联动起来。如下所示。

图片

        这个时候,我们只要将其他3个数据框的范围指定给定义了数据驱动页面的电子街道地图数据框就可以了。设置参数如下,范围选择其他数据框然后指定给电子街道数据框,边距选择100%。其他数据框同一设置。这样简单的设置就可以实现各个数据框的联动。

图片

        那问题又来了,这样虽然可以实现各个数据框联动了,但是如果有些图斑相互接近,一个图幅里面就不能显示单一的图斑了,虽然可以通过之前《ArcPy结合数据驱动模块的批量制图》介绍的通过页面定义查询的方式实现单一图斑的显示,但是因为数据驱动页面的索引图层是不能设置页面定义查询,所以必然存在一个数据框的图斑无法单一显示。

图片

如下图。

图片

那我们有什么方法可以解决这个问题呢?欢迎报名我们的课程

《ArcPy结合数据驱动模块的批量制图》

我们一起来解决这个问题

点击链接学习

ArcPy结合数据驱动模块的批量制图(GIS思维)icon-default.png?t=N7T8https://edu.csdn.net/course/detail/28073

02  ArcPy实现多数据框批量联动出图


        第二个新增的内容就是我们经常会碰到需要监测图斑前后时相截图且标出图斑位置以及相关信息,如图。

图片

以上内容的实现,只需要在《ArcPy结合数据驱动模块的批量制图》结合ArcPy的Mapping模块批量出图(arcpy.mapping)之结合形状指数动态修改地图比例尺上配置好地图页面,然后增加3-4句简单的代码就可以实现

图片

那这个内容这里就不多说,我们课程新增部分会详细介绍语句的添加与工具的配置。

欢迎报名我们的课程

《ArcPy结合数据驱动模块的批量制图》

我们一起来解锁新方法

 点击链接学习

ArcPy结合数据驱动模块的批量制图(GIS思维)icon-default.png?t=N7T8https://edu.csdn.net/course/detail/28073

课程目录

图片

图片

图片

 点击链接学习

ArcPy结合数据驱动模块的批量制图(GIS思维)icon-default.png?t=N7T8https://edu.csdn.net/course/detail/28073

购课即送工具、数据福利

图片

图片

购课后找小编领取福利哦

这篇关于ArcGIS多数据框联动批量出图的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/916266

相关文章

Pandas统计每行数据中的空值的方法示例

《Pandas统计每行数据中的空值的方法示例》处理缺失数据(NaN值)是一个非常常见的问题,本文主要介绍了Pandas统计每行数据中的空值的方法示例,具有一定的参考价值,感兴趣的可以了解一下... 目录什么是空值?为什么要统计空值?准备工作创建示例数据统计每行空值数量进一步分析www.chinasem.cn处

如何使用 Python 读取 Excel 数据

《如何使用Python读取Excel数据》:本文主要介绍使用Python读取Excel数据的详细教程,通过pandas和openpyxl,你可以轻松读取Excel文件,并进行各种数据处理操... 目录使用 python 读取 Excel 数据的详细教程1. 安装必要的依赖2. 读取 Excel 文件3. 读

Spring 请求之传递 JSON 数据的操作方法

《Spring请求之传递JSON数据的操作方法》JSON就是一种数据格式,有自己的格式和语法,使用文本表示一个对象或数组的信息,因此JSON本质是字符串,主要负责在不同的语言中数据传递和交换,这... 目录jsON 概念JSON 语法JSON 的语法JSON 的两种结构JSON 字符串和 Java 对象互转

C++如何通过Qt反射机制实现数据类序列化

《C++如何通过Qt反射机制实现数据类序列化》在C++工程中经常需要使用数据类,并对数据类进行存储、打印、调试等操作,所以本文就来聊聊C++如何通过Qt反射机制实现数据类序列化吧... 目录设计预期设计思路代码实现使用方法在 C++ 工程中经常需要使用数据类,并对数据类进行存储、打印、调试等操作。由于数据类

SpringBoot使用GZIP压缩反回数据问题

《SpringBoot使用GZIP压缩反回数据问题》:本文主要介绍SpringBoot使用GZIP压缩反回数据问题,具有很好的参考价值,希望对大家有所帮助,如有错误或未考虑完全的地方,望不吝赐教... 目录SpringBoot使用GZIP压缩反回数据1、初识gzip2、gzip是什么,可以干什么?3、Spr

SpringBoot集成Milvus实现数据增删改查功能

《SpringBoot集成Milvus实现数据增删改查功能》milvus支持的语言比较多,支持python,Java,Go,node等开发语言,本文主要介绍如何使用Java语言,采用springboo... 目录1、Milvus基本概念2、添加maven依赖3、配置yml文件4、创建MilvusClient

SpringValidation数据校验之约束注解与分组校验方式

《SpringValidation数据校验之约束注解与分组校验方式》本文将深入探讨SpringValidation的核心功能,帮助开发者掌握约束注解的使用技巧和分组校验的高级应用,从而构建更加健壮和可... 目录引言一、Spring Validation基础架构1.1 jsR-380标准与Spring整合1

MySQL 中查询 VARCHAR 类型 JSON 数据的问题记录

《MySQL中查询VARCHAR类型JSON数据的问题记录》在数据库设计中,有时我们会将JSON数据存储在VARCHAR或TEXT类型字段中,本文将详细介绍如何在MySQL中有效查询存储为V... 目录一、问题背景二、mysql jsON 函数2.1 常用 JSON 函数三、查询示例3.1 基本查询3.2

SpringBatch数据写入实现

《SpringBatch数据写入实现》SpringBatch通过ItemWriter接口及其丰富的实现,提供了强大的数据写入能力,本文主要介绍了SpringBatch数据写入实现,具有一定的参考价值,... 目录python引言一、ItemWriter核心概念二、数据库写入实现三、文件写入实现四、多目标写入

使用Python将JSON,XML和YAML数据写入Excel文件

《使用Python将JSON,XML和YAML数据写入Excel文件》JSON、XML和YAML作为主流结构化数据格式,因其层次化表达能力和跨平台兼容性,已成为系统间数据交换的通用载体,本文将介绍如何... 目录如何使用python写入数据到Excel工作表用Python导入jsON数据到Excel工作表用